Poultry Strategy for Feed Efficiency and Heat Tolerance
The poultry farmer aims to improve bird performance by selecting for specific traits: low feed consumption, high heat tolerance, and the ability to produce quality chicks. The strategy must directly address these genetic or inherent characteristics.
Evaluating Breeding Strategies
- Cross-breeding exotic and local poultry is the most suitable strategy. Exotic breeds often possess high production potential and feed conversion efficiency, while local breeds typically exhibit better adaptation to local environmental conditions, including heat tolerance and disease resistance. Combining these breeds through cross-breeding can result in hybrid vigour (heterosis), enhancing overall performance and combining the desired traits effectively. This approach directly targets improved feed efficiency, heat tolerance, and chick quality.
- Feeding management strategies, like feeding twice a day, affect feed intake but do not fundamentally alter the birds' genetic capacity for feed efficiency or heat tolerance.
- Shifting to fish farming is an unrelated diversification strategy and does not address poultry farming goals.
- Relying solely on indigenous birds guarantees heat tolerance but may not achieve the desired levels of feed efficiency or rapid chick quality improvement compared to introducing beneficial traits via cross-breeding.
Therefore, cross-breeding offers a scientifically sound method to achieve the farmer's specific objectives.
